Carrot Soup

Carrot soup is a smooth, creamy, and comforting pureed soup made primarily from carrots, often sautéed with onions and garlic, then simmered in broth before being blended. It's a classic dish found in various forms across many cuisines, from simple European home cooking to spiced versions in North African and Asian traditions.

🍽️ Nutrition at a glance

This soup is generally low in fat and protein, with its carbohydrates coming mainly from the natural sugars in carrots. It is an excellent source of vitamin A (from beta-carotene) and provides a good amount of fiber, with a typical serving containing roughly 80-120 calories.

💡 What's interesting

Carrot soup's vibrant orange color comes from beta-carotene, an antioxidant the body converts to vitamin A, which is essential for eye health. Its versatility allows it to be served hot or cold, and it's often enhanced with spices like ginger, cumin, or a swirl of cream, making it a beloved canvas for culinary creativity.
